Nestled in Slidell, Louisiana, Los Antojitos is a delightful Honduran restaurant that promises an authentic experience filled with vibrant flavors. From the moment you step inside, you'll be enveloped in the warm, inviting atmosphere that showcases the rich cultural heritage of Honduras, complemented by a menu bursting with traditional dishes that will tantalize your taste buds.

Walking
From the center of Slidell, head west on Gause Blvd E. Continue walking straight for about 1.5 miles. You will pass several local shops and restaurants along the way. After crossing the intersection with Robert Blvd, continue for another block until you reach 106 Gause Blvd W. Los Antojitos will be on your left side, right next to a convenience store.
Public Transport
If you are near the Slidell Transit Center, take the Route 6 bus heading west towards Gause Blvd. Stay on the bus for approximately 10 minutes. Get off at the stop at Gause Blvd and Robert Blvd. From there, walk west for about 5 minutes, and you will find Los Antojitos at 106 Gause Blvd W, on your left.
Biking
If you are renting a bike, start from the center of Slidell and head towards Gause Blvd E. Follow the bike lane along Gause Blvd for about 1.5 miles. After passing the intersection with Robert Blvd, continue biking for one more block until you see Los Antojitos at 106 Gause Blvd W on your left. There are bike racks available near the entrance.
